The smallest dog ever recorded was a Chihuahua named Miracle Milly, weighing only 1 pound at maturity.
Huskies have a unique ability to modify their metabolism, allowing them to run long distances while conserving energy.
Revered companions in ancient Toltec civilization of Mexico, these small dogs served as sacred animals and cherished companions to nobility during the pre-Columbian era.
Developed by the Chukchi people of northeastern Asia for sledding and hunting in harsh Arctic conditions. These dogs were vital for survival, pulling heavy loads across vast frozen landscapes.
Requires protection from cold weather, careful handling due to fragile build, and attention to dental health. Regular grooming and consistent training essential.
Requires secure fencing to prevent escape. Heavy seasonal shedding needs regular brushing. High exercise demands must be met to prevent destructive behavior.
